As we move deeper into the holiday shopping season consumers aren’t happy. Inflation continues to eat away at their buying power and they are carrying $1.03 trillion in credit card debt, an all-time record sure to be broken as soon as the Fed releases third quarter statistics. There is some good news, of course. The recession that was around the corner for the last couple of years has officially been banished to a corner farther away. Also, the unemployment rate remains blessedly low and wages are slowly rising. Any marketer will tell you this calls for campaigns built around price and value. But, how do you stand out if that’s what everyone is doing? Gartner suggests risking the wrath of some part of the public by emphasizing inclusivity, environmentalism and social justice.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
